Navy Releases 2010 Men's Water Polo Schedule
BRIDGEPORT, Pa. -- The United States Naval Academy will seek to return to the top of the Collegiate Water Polo Association (CWPA) men's varsity rankings this year as the Midshipmen announced their schedule of games for the 2010 season. Outside league play, the Mids will travel to the Bucknell Invitational and the NorCal Tournament in addition to hosting the Navy Open during the regular season.
Following a second place finish at the 2009 CWPA Eastern Championship hosted by the Massachusetts Institute of Technology to finish the season with a 22-9 mark, the Midshipmen will open the season at home in Annapolis, Md. on September 4-5 with the Navy Open. The next weekend, Navy will travel into Pennsylvania to take part in the Bucknell Invitational on September 11-12 against fellow CWPA institutions Queens College (N.Y.), St. Francis College (N.Y.), Brown University and Pennsylvania State University-The Behrend College, along with Diablo Valley College.
Facing potentially their most potent opponents of the season, the Mids will trek to Berkeley, Calif. to participate in the NorCal Tournament at the University of California on September 18-19. Last year's tournament had 14 of the top 16 teams in the country competing, as the Midshipmen's potential national ranking and seeding at the NCAA Championship, if Navy wins the CWPA Eastern Championship, at the end of the season will be impacted by the outcome of the games.
Following a home game against CWPA Southern Division, Western Region member Washington & Jefferson College on September 24, the Blue & Gold will begin the Southern Division, East Region season on September 25 against Bucknell University and defending Eastern Champion Princeton University at home.
Navy will make its first conference road-trip on October 6 travelling to Johns Hopkins University and George Washington Unviersity in Baltimore, Md. and Washington, D.C., respectively.
The road games will continue as away contests at Bucknell and Princeton will occur on October 16 before the Midshipmen return to port on October 30 to wrap up the league regular season schedule at home against George Washington and Johns Hopkins.
Navy will remain at home for the Southern Division Championship tournament on November 5-7 at Scott Natatorium. Navy has won 12 of the 17 Southern Division championships the league has contested.
If the Midshipmen can pick up lucky title No. 13 or finish among the top four teams in the South, the squad will advance to the newly redubbed CWPA Eastern Championship on November 19-21 in Lewisburg, Pa. on the campus of Bucknell.
Navy, and the rest of the eight-team field, will battle for the league's title and a berth to the NCAA Championship to be held on December 4-5 at the University of California.
